[U: Officially Announced] Android 14 beta will be available soon for Nothing Phone (1)

May 11/2023: Nothing officially announced the launch of its developer preview program.

The known problems are as follows:

  • Fingerprints cannot be registered
  • Face unlock is not available
  • Glyph functionality is not available
  • battery sharing not available
  • No portrait mode or slow-mo features in the camera app
  • No pre-installed Nothing weather and Nothing X apps
  • Screen casting to TV connection is not available.
